Report: Spurs make move to snap up striker from under Serie A giant’s noses

The latest reports from France indicate that Tottenham Hotspur are making a last-ditch attempt to steal Victor Osimhen from under Napoli’s noses.

The Lille striker, who has had a sensational debut season in Ligue 1 has reportedly been on Spurs’ radar since the January transfer window (Sky Sports).

Reports previously indicated that the North Londoners had made a £62million offer to sign the Lille star this summer (Radio Kiss Kiss via Area Napoli).

However, it looked like Napoli had won the race for the 21-year-old with reports indicating that Osimhen was set to complete a move to Gennaro Gattuso side. (Sky Sport Italia via Goal.com).

It now looks like the Lilywhites have made another attempt to land the Nigerian international after his proposed move to Naples reportedly experienced issues.

French journalist Manu Lonjon has claimed that Osimhen is set to hold talks with Tottenham in the next 48 hours before deciding on his next destination.

Meanwhile, RMC Sport’s Mohamed Bouhafsi has revealed that Napoli still need to sort out a few details to complete the transfer, which they hope to do in the next 48 hours.

Bouhafsi suggests that Tottenham and one other unnamed English club are trying to take advantage of the delay and move for the striker.

However, the Serie A giants are said to be confident of completing the deal.
